In this message, we're wrapping up our High Ground series at Church of Hope with Jesus' story of two builders — one who built his faith on rock, one who built on sand. Same storm. Same anxiety. Same uncertainty. Completely different outcome. And the difference was never what people could see from the outside.
This isn't a message about having a bad day. It's about what's actually holding your life together when the pressure hits — your marriage, your mental health, your finances, your faith, your future. We'll talk about why comfort always looks more appealing than obedience, why "Lord, Lord" isn't the same thing as actually knowing Jesus, and how to build a foundation today that will still be standing when the storm comes tomorrow.
